Trainer spending: 1–60
Costs show the base trainer price. Discounts can lower what you pay; totals use the highest applicable race or faction route.
1–9
-
Level 1
-
Learn now
Track Beasts
Free scouting before caves, escorts, and patrol routes.
-
-
Level 4
-
Learn now
Serpent Sting
Rank 1
Efficient damage-over-time for longer pet-held pulls.
-
Learn now
Aspect of the Monkey
Dodge aspect for melee pressure or a rough pull.
-
-
Level 6
-
Learn now
Hunter's Mark
Rank 1
Mark before the pet engages for a clean focus target and more damage.
-
Learn now
Arcane Shot
Rank 1
Instant ranged damage for runners and clean finishes.
-
-
Level 8
-
Learn now
Parry
A parry buys time when a target gets through the pet.
-
Learn now
Concussive Shot
Runner slow and space-maker. Keep it ready when the pet loses a target.
-
Learn now
Raptor Strike
Rank 1
Current melee hit for the rare time you must stand your ground.
-
